The Office of Administration, Information Technology Services Division (OA-ITSD) is seeking an experienced Database Administrator to support and advance our enterprise database infrastructure, with a primary focus on Microsoft SQL Server technologies. This role includes advanced responsibilities in database administration, such as performance tuning, high availability, security, and platform integration. This role will also lead technical projects, including infrastructure upgrades and complex system migrations, ensuring timely delivery, adherence to standards, and alignment with organizational goals. Ideal candidates will have experience managing complex SQL Server environments and a strong understanding of database architecture and operational best practices. In addition to hands-on technical work, this role involves mentoring junior team members, maintaining documentation, and collaborating across teams to drive data platform improvements. A proactive, detail-oriented, and solutions-driven mindset is essential for success in this position.
